Nets’ Ziaire Williams: Starting vs. Philadelphia

Williams is in the Nets‘ starting lineup against the 76ers on Saturday, Sharif Phillips-Keaton of USA Today reports.
Williams missed the Nets’ last two games due to an illness. He’s been given the green light to return for Saturday’s matinee and will make his sixth start of the season due to the absences of Michael Porter (ankle) and Drake Powell (knee). Williams’ last start was Feb. 11 against…

CHR BC DStar Net Friday Feb 26

The CHR BC DStar Net will be at 9:35-9:40 tomorrow morning. The net is open to all hams. We can be found on VA7ICM B, VE7SUN B or reflector 16B.

NBA Roundup: Durant leads Rockets past Nets for fourth straight win

Kevin Durant had 22 points and a season-high 11 assists, Amen Thompson scored 23 points and the Houston Rockets beat the Brooklyn Nets 120-96 on Thursday night for its fourth straight victory.
Alperen Sengun had 20 points, six rebounds and six assists after a two-game absence for the Rockets, who started fast in both halves to win in Brooklyn for the first time in seven years. Tari Eason finished…
